What we do

The South Tyneside Children and Young People’s Diabetes team is committed to providing high quality care to children and young people with Type 1 Diabetes. We follow regional and national guidelines. Our purpose is to ensure a co-ordinated, child-centred approach to the diagnosis, treatment and continuing management for these children, young people and their families.The ultimate aim is to empower them to manage their diabetes with confidence in all situations, to support and enable them to achieve their maximum potential in all aspects of life. 

We utilise all endorsed technology and submit data to the National Paediatric Diabetes Audit annually and act upon these reports to continually develop our service further.  We are very proud of our achievements as one of the top performing units in the country.
